WebMixers and Modulators . MIXER AND MODULATOR OVERVIEW . An idealized mixer is shown in Figure 1. An RF (or IF) mixer (not to be confused with video and audio mixers) is an active or passive device that converts a signal from one frequency to another. It can either modulate or demodulate a signal.
